Trip Overview

The drive from Toms River, NJ to High Bridge, NJ covers 81.6 miles and takes about 1h 44m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.

The route leans on NJ 18, Garden State Parkway, Phillipsburg-Newark Expressway for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is highway-focused dr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 22.2 miles on NJ 18. At current regular gas prices, budget about $13.50 one way before food or hotel costs.

Morristown National Historical Park

Morristown National Historical Park

National Historical Park

Morristown National Historical Park commemorates the sites of General Washington and the Continental Army’s winter encampment from December 1779 to June 1780, where soldiers survived the coldest winte...
